FAIRTRADE certified contracts guarantee coffee farmers a minimum price for their beans, so their costs of production are covered. The farmers are also paid a premium, which enables them to invest in their communities to improve living and working conditions.
ORGANIC certification means that coffee farmers avoid unnecessary chemicals and pesticides - good news for plant and animal life. Organic certification also means more money to the farmers, over and above the Fairtrade price.
THE RAINFOREST ALLIANCE seal means that farms look after the tropical forests where they live and work. Wildlife is protected, rivers kept clean and natural resources untouched.

Richardson Oils is a family run business based in Coatbridge, just off the M8 Motorway. Richardson Oils have been trading for over 15 years and started initially as a waste oil collection service. Sales of fresh oil, dry store food products and catering disposables have increasingly formed the major part of their business.
Simon Howie began his first butchery business from the Perthshire village of Dunning, where it quickly established an outstanding reputation for supplying meat to restaurants and hotels. A state of the art factory was built to keep up with demand from which it continues to supply butchery and chef prepared products to chefs, restaurants and many of the UK's leading supermarkets. Although Simon Howie Butchers is now a much bigger operation, traditional craft skills are still practised, quite literally taking the concept of a local butcher into the supermarket arena.
